Neurotransmitter
Chemical substances in the nervous system that transmit signals across a synapse from one neuron to another.
Serotonin
A neurotransmitter that plays a crucial role in mood regulation, as well as in sleep, digestion, and other bodily functions.
Behaviorist Model
A theory of learning that emphasizes observable behaviors and the ways they're learned through conditioning processes without regard to thoughts or feelings.
